What Is the Cost of Living Near Frederick?

Understanding the cost of living near Frederick is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Hagerstown Community College.
Frederick's Cost of Living Index is approximately 115.9 (15.9% more expensive than US average; 2.6% more than MD average). Growing city NW of DC/Baltimore, historic downtown, housing costs above US avg. TransIT bus, MARC train. When planning your budget based on a salary from Hagerstown Community College,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,600 - $2,300+ A significant portion of Hagerstown Community College sal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$150 - $260 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$40 (TransIT monthly pass, MARC extra)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$430 - $640 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$380 - $700+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$390 - $720+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$3,000 - $4,620+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
